Hochul signs legislation to protect rights of seniors with HIV, members of LGBTQIA+ community
Thu, Nov 30th 2023 07:55 pm
Gov. Kathy Hochul has signed legislation S.1783A/A.372A, which establishes a bill of rights for long-term care facility residents who are l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ender, or living with HIV. The bill prohibits long-term care facilities and their staff from discriminating against any resident on the basis of a resident's actual or perceived sexual orientation, gender identity or expression, or HIV status.

Hochul signs legislation to keep kids safe from cardiac emergencies
Tue, Nov 28th 2023 01:40 pm
Gov. Kathy Hochul has signed legislation S.7424/A.366A requiring camps and youth sports programs to establish automated external defibrillator implementation plans and to have at least one person trained to properly use the AED at camps, games and practice.

NYS: Matthew's Law will allow drug testing supplies to be distributed by health care professionals or pharmacists
Mon, Nov 20th 2023 12:45 pm
Gov. Kathy Hochul signed legislation that "continues aggressive efforts to address the opioid and overdose epidemic." Matthew's Law, or S.2099C/A.5200B, expands the public's access to fentanyl testing supplies, a resource that protects public health by decreasing the chances of an accidental drug overdose.
